[QUOTE="Time to hit the road, post: 374496, member: 11335"] Thanks for all the replies. Went with a GM 1000 and using it in the Golden triangle. It's been close to 2 weeks using almost everyday for a few hours but have found no yellow stuff. I have a few questions on the best settings for it. I've been setting it on all metal mode at about level 6. I don't get very far and it goes off, digging a hole every couple of meters or so. Lead shot, nails, bullet heads, casings, rocks that make it go beep. Getting frustrated with it would be an understatement. Get a signal and dig a hole and the whole hole sounds like R2D2 on party drugs. Maybe I should post this in a more relevant spot. How do you set this machine to perform at it's best?
